52
Khởi động Linux lần đầu
Bảng 3.3: Tổ hợp phím điều khiển lịch sử lệnh
Phím
Phản ứng của hệ thống
<↑> hoặc <Ctrl>+<P>
Chuyển tới (gọi vào dòng lệnh) câu lệnh trước
trong danh sách (di chuyển ngược lại danh sách)
<↓> hoặc <Ctrl>+<N>
Chuyển tới câu lệnh tiếp theo trong danh sách
(di chuyển theo danh sách)
<PgUp>
Chuyển tới câu lệnh đầu tiên trong danh sách
lịch sử lệnh
<!>, <N>
Thực hiện (không cần nhấn <Enter> câu lệnh
thứ n trong danh sách
<!>, <->, <N>
Thực hiện câu lệnh thứ n tính từ cuối danh sách
<!>, dòng_ký_tự
Thực hiện dòng lệnh, có phần đầu trùng với
dòng_ký_tự
. Việc tìm dòng lệnh cần thiết sẽ
được thực hiện từ cuối tập tin lịch sử và dòng
lệnh đầu tiên tìm thấy sẽ được thực hiện
<Ctrl>+<O>
Cũng giống như nhấn phím <Enter>, sau đó
hiển thị câu lệnh tiếp theo trong lịch sử lệnh
tạm chúng trong bộ nhớ (cache). Nếu ngắt nguồn điện thì những thay đổi này sẽ
không được lưu và sẽ bị mất, đôi khi có thể dẫn đến không khởi động được máy
trong lần sau. Do đó cần biết dừng hệ thống một cách đúng đắn trước khi tắt
máy. Công việc này do câu lệnh (chương trình) shutdown đảm nhiệm.
Chỉ có người dùng root mới có thể thực hiện câu lệnh shutdown này
, do đó
bạn cần đăng nhập vào hệ thống dưới tên người dùng này, hoặc dùng câu lệnh
su
để có đủ quyền tương ứng. Câu lệnh shutdown có cú pháp như sau:
[root]# shutdown <tùy_chọn> <thời_gian> <dòng_thông_báo>
Ghi chú: Rất có thể khi chạy lệnh, bạn sẽ nhận được câu trả lời “bash: shutdown:
command not found
”. Điều đó có nghĩa là bash không biết tìm chương trình ở đây.
Trong trường hợp đó bạn cần nhập vào đường dẫn đầy đủ đến chương trình, ở đây là
/sbin/shutdown
, vì tập tin chương trình của shutdown nằm tại /sbin.
Thường sử dụng hai trong số các tùy chọn của chương trình shutdown:
-h – dừng hoàn toàn hệ thống (halt, sẽ tắt máy)
-r – khởi động lại hệ thống (reboot).
Tham số thời_gian dùng để “hẹn giờ” thực hiện câu lệnh (không nhất thiết
phải thực hiện câu lệnh ngay lập tức). Thời gian hẹn giờ được tính từ lúc nhấn
phím <Enter>. Ví dụ, nếu bạn muốn khởi động lại sau 5 phút thì hãy nhập vào
câu lệnh:
[root]# shutdown -r +5
Câu lệnh này có nghĩa là “dừng hệ thống sau 5 phút và khởi động lại sau khi
hoàn thành công việc”. Đối với chúng ta thì tạm thời câu lệnh sau sẽ thích hợp
hơn:
6
Cũng có thể cấu hình để những người dùng khác thực hiện được shutdown, ví dụ qua sudo.